Stencil Plate - Ballarat Lunatic Asylum, Metal, circa 1900
Reg. No: SH 850031
- Summary:
- Square metal stencil plate used for labelling objects 'Ballarat Lunatic Asylum', circa 1900. Used at the Ballarat Lunatic Asylum, a mental health hospital in Ballarat, Victoria, Australia, circa 1900
- Description:
- Square metal stencil-plate with lettering cut in a circular shape. There is an almost indecipherable semi-circular stamp-mark on the top edge.
- Acquisition Information:
- Donation from Lakeside Mental Hospital
